#4e9c14 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4e9c14 is composed of 30.6% red, 61.2% green and 7.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 50% cyan, 0% magenta, 87.2% yellow and 38.8% black. It has a hue angle of 94.4 degrees, a saturation of 77.3% and a lightness of 34.5%. #4e9c14 color hex could be obtained by blending #9cff28 with #003900. Closest websafe color is: #669900.

Shades and Tints of #4e9c14
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#081102 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#4e9c14
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#585858 is the less saturated color, while #4caa06 is the most saturated one.
